WebTricritical Point in Holographic Superfluid Wung-Hong Huang ... coupled regimes of field theories, such as in the quark-gluon plasma [1,2,3]. ... point can be analyzed from the … Tricritical point refers to a point where the second order phase transition curve meet the first order phase transition curve, which was first introduced by Lev Landau in 1937, wherein Landau called the tricritical point as the critical point of the continuous transition. The first example of the tricritical point was shown by Robert B. Griffiths in helium-3 helium-4 mixture.
